Raimondo Recommends Infante-Green As RI’s Next Education Commissioner
Rhode Island Gov. Gina Raimondo is turning to Angélica Infante-Green – a one-time teacher in the South Bronx who was a finalist last year to become Massachusetts’ education commissioner – to take on the challenge of improving public education in Rhode Island.

RI House Approves Bill To Guarantee Abortion Rights
In a 44 to 30 vote, the Rhode Island House of Representatives on Thursday moved the state one step closer to guaranteeing a woman’s right to an abortion.
RI House Judiciary Committee Moves Abortion Bill To Full House Vote
Rhode Island’s House Judiciary Committee broke a longstanding standoff on abortion-related bills Tuesday by narrowly approving a measure to codify Roe vs. Wade in the state.
